Dolce & Gabbana: A Legacy of Italian Craftsmanship:
The Dolce & Gabbana brand is synonymous with Italian luxury. Founded in 1985 by Domenico Dolce and Stefano Gabbana, the label quickly established itself as a powerhouse in the fashion world, celebrated for its opulent designs, bold silhouettes, and masterful use of fabrics.
